By Brandon Marcello, 247Sports: Oregon owns the last two Pac-12 championships and the Ducks are favored to win a third this fall, but at some point even the best stage routine grows stale.
Success breeds confidence, but maintaining that level of success ultimately leads to stagnation, which in athletics translates to regression, especially in college football. Players want more wins, they want different trophies and accolades, and fans begin to demand a different trajectory.
